The mobile sexual reproductive parts of seedless plants are sperm cells. These sperm cells are typically flagellated, allowing them to swim through water to reach the egg for fertilization. Seedless plants rely on water for the transfer of sperm to the egg, unlike seed plants which have pollen to transport sperm to the egg.

Seedless plants require the liquid water because the sperm has to swim to reach the egg. This is in contrast to most seed plants, that fertilize using pollen transferred by wind or insects.
The mobile sexual reproductive parts of seedless plants are sperm cells. These sperm cells are typically flagellated, allowing them to swim through water to reach the egg for fertilization. Seedless plants rely on water for the transfer of sperm to the egg, unlike seed plants which have pollen to transport sperm to the egg.
The sperm of seed plants form inside the pollen tube, a structure that develops from the pollen grain. The pollen tube grows towards the ovule to deliver the sperm cells for fertilization.
